Understanding Cassis Blackcurrant
Botanical Origins and History
Cassis, the French term for blackcurrant liqueur, originates from the Ribes nigrum plant, a species of blackcurrant native to Europe and Asia. While blackcurrants have a long history of use in jams, jellies, and other culinary applications, their transformation into the sophisticated Cassis liqueur is a relatively recent development, gaining significant popularity in the 20th century.
- Key growing regions: France (particularly Burgundy), Eastern Europe, and parts of North America are known for cultivating high-quality blackcurrants.
- Historical uses: Beyond liqueur, blackcurrants have historically been used in traditional medicine for their purported health benefits and as a key ingredient in pies, preserves, and cordials.
- Interesting facts: The intense aroma of blackcurrants comes from a complex mixture of aromatic compounds, including esters and ketones, contributing to their unique flavor.
The Unique Flavor Profile of Cassis
Cassis blackcurrant boasts a distinctive flavor profile. It’s intensely fruity with a beautiful balance of sweet and tart notes. The flavor is often described as deeply aromatic, with hints of dark fruit, subtle herbal undertones, and a refreshing acidity that cuts through sweetness. It differs from other berries by having a more complex, less sugary, and more intensely flavored profile.
- Tasting notes: Deeply fruity, tart, slightly herbal, dark fruit notes, lingering sweetness.
- Flavor intensity: Cassis possesses a strong flavor that can dominate other ingredients, making it ideal for liqueurs and sauces where it's the star.
- Flavor development: The flavor intensity can mellow slightly with heat, so adjust usage based on the cooking method.
Nutritional Benefits of Cassis Blackcurrant
Blackcurrants are nutritional powerhouses, packed with v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ants. They are an excellent source of Vitamin C, Vitamin K, and various phytochemicals associated with several health benefits.
- Specific vitamins & minerals: Vitamin C, Vitamin K, manganese, fiber.
- Antioxidant properties: Rich in anthocyanins, responsible for its deep color and potent antioxidant capabilities.
- Potential health benefits: Studies suggest blackcurrants may help improve cardiovascular health, reduce inflammation, and boost immune function. (Note: Further research is needed to confirm these benefits.)
Culinary Uses of Cassis Blackcurrant
Cassis in Cocktails and Liqueurs
Cassis is most famously known as the base of the Kir Royale, a classic cocktail made with crème de Cassis and Champagne. However, its versatility extends far beyond this signature drink.
- Popular cocktails featuring Cassis: Kir Royale, Cassis Smash, Cassis Sour, Blackberry Bramble (often incorporates blackberry liqueur alongside Cassis).
- Tips for using Cassis in cocktails: A little goes a long way. Start with a small amount and adjust to taste. Consider the other ingredients to ensure flavor balance.
- Suggested cocktail pairings: Cassis pairs exceptionally well with sparkling wines, Champagne, gin, vodka, and even tequila.
Cassis in Desserts and Baking
The rich, tart flavor of Cassis blackcurrant lends itself beautifully to desserts. Its vibrant color adds visual appeal too.

- Tips for incorporating Cassis into baking: Balance the tartness with added sugar or other sweeteners. Consider complementary flavors like chocolate, almond, or vanilla.
- Flavor combinations: Cassis complements chocolate, vanilla, almond, citrus fruits, and even spices like cinnamon.
Cassis in Savory Dishes
While less common, Cassis can add a surprising depth and complexity to savory dishes. Its tartness cuts through richness, while its fruity notes add an unexpected twist.
- Savory recipes or examples: Cassis reduction for duck or game meats, Cassis marinade for lamb or pork, Cassis vinaigrette.
- Pairing suggestions for savory dishes: Cassis works well with game meats, poultry, lamb, and rich cheeses.
- Tips for using Cassis in savory cooking: Use it sparingly at first, and let the flavor develop slowly. Consider reducing the Cassis to intensify its flavor and create a syrupy consistency.
Sourcing and Selecting High-Quality Cassis Blackcurrant
Identifying Quality Cassis Products
Choosing high-quality Cassis products ensures the best flavor and experience.
- Things to look for on labels: Look for labels indicating the origin of the blackcurrants (e.g., Burgundy, France), and the percentage of blackcurrant used. Check for certifications, such as organic labels, if desired.
- Indicators of quality: Rich, deep color, complex aroma, balanced sweetness and tartness.
- Where to buy authentic Cassis: Specialty food stores, liquor stores, and online retailers specializing in gourmet food items are good places to start.
Storing Cassis Blackcurrant Products
Proper storage is vital to preserve the quality of your Cassis blackcurrant products.
- Storage temperature: Store unopened bottles in a cool, dark place. Once opened, refrigerate and consume within a reasonable timeframe (check bottle instructions).
- Shelf life: Unopened bottles have a long shelf life. Once opened, refrigeration extends the life but consumption within a few weeks is recommended.
- Storage containers: Store leftover Cassis in airtight containers to maintain its flavor and prevent spoilage.
